Digital-First Operations

We've been nearly paper-free in our office since 2013, utilizing digital platforms for contracts, invoices, planning documents, and internal communications. When printing is absolutely necessary, we use recycled paper and eco-friendly inks.

Waste Reduction Strategy

We actively minimize waste at every stage of event production, from planning through execution. Our team ensures proper sorting and disposal of all materials, implementing comprehensive recycling and composting programs that go beyond basic requirements.

Holistic Resource Management

We guide clients in managing their special events with a holistic approach, carefully considering the total resources used including materials, energy, water, and transportation. Every decision is made with environmental impact in mind.

Reuse & Repurpose Philosophy

We encourage and facilitate the reuse of all resources wherever possible. From decor elements to production materials, we design with longevity and multiple applications in mind, reducing single-use items across all our events.

Sustainable Promotional Items

We work closely with clients to identify meaningful, sustainable promotional items that align with their brand values and event goals. We prioritize products made from recycled or renewable materials that recipients will actually use and treasure.

Local Vendor Partnerships

We partner with local San Francisco Bay Area vendors who share our commitment to sustainability, supporting the local economy while reducing transportation emissions and fostering a community of environmentally conscious businesses.

Looking Forward: Our Sustainability Aspirations

As we continue to grow and evolve, we're committed to pushing the boundaries of what's possible in sustainable event production. Here's where we're headed:

Carbon Footprint Reduction

  • Event Carbon Assessment: Develop comprehensive tools to measure and report the carbon footprint of every event we produce, providing clients with transparent data and actionable reduction strategies.

  • Carbon Offset Programs: Partner with verified carbon offset organizations to neutralize the unavoidable emissions from our events, investing in reforestation and renewable energy projects.

  • Transportation Solutions: Encourage and facilitate use of public transportation, electric vehicle shuttles, and carpooling for event attendees, reducing emissions from guest travel.

Zero-Waste Event Design

  • Comprehensive Waste Diversion: Work toward achieving 90%+ waste diversion rates at all our events through meticulous planning, proper infrastructure, and attendee education.

  • Compostable Service Ware: Eliminate all single-use plastics and transition to fully compostable or reusable service ware for catering and beverage service at all events.

  • Material Recovery Partnerships: Establish relationships with organizations that can repurpose leftover event materials, including donating food, decor, and supplies to community organizations.

Sustainable Venue Selection

  • Green-Certified Priority: Prioritize venues with LEED certification, renewable energy sources, and strong environmental policies, helping drive demand for sustainable event spaces across the Bay Area.

  • Energy-Efficient Technology: Utilize LED lighting, energy-efficient AV equipment, and smart power management systems to minimize energy consumption at every event.

  • Water Conservation: Work with venues and caterers to implement water-saving practices, from low-flow facilities to mindful beverage service.

Sustainable Catering Practices

  • Plant-Forward Menus: Offer and encourage plant-based menu options that significantly reduce the environmental impact of event catering while providing delicious, innovative cuisine.

  • Local & Seasonal Sourcing: Partner with caterers who prioritize locally sourced, seasonal ingredients, supporting regional agriculture and reducing transportation emissions.

  • Food Waste Prevention: Implement precise guest count systems and work with donation partners to ensure excess food reaches those in need rather than landfills.

Education & Advocacy

  • Client Sustainability Consulting: Expand our role as sustainability advisors, helping clients understand the environmental impact of their events and make informed decisions that align with their corporate responsibility goals.

  • Industry Leadership: Share our knowledge and best practices with the broader event industry through workshops, speaking engagements, and collaborative initiatives that raise the bar for sustainable event production.

  • Supplier Engagement: Work with our vendor network to encourage and support their own sustainability initiatives, creating a ripple effect throughout the event ecosystem.

Innovation & Technology

  • Virtual & Hybrid Solutions: Continue developing sophisticated virtual and hybrid event capabilities that reduce travel-related emissions while maintaining exceptional attendee experiences.

  • Digital Event Materials: Expand use of event apps, digital signage, and QR codes to eliminate printed programs, signage, and promotional materials.

  • Sustainable Innovation Partnerships: Collaborate with innovators developing new sustainable event technologies and materials, being early adopters of solutions that benefit both our clients and the environment.
